Paddy's Limbo, (sculpture).
Artist:
Chamberlain, John, 1927-2011, sculptor.
Title:
Paddy's Limbo, (sculpture).
Dates:
1976-1977.
Medium:
Painted and chromium-plated steel.
Dimensions:
51 x 27 x 21 in. (129.5 x 68.5 x 53.5 cm.).
Description:
Long, vertical piece, mostly in chrome, with various colors of paint dripped or splattered onto the many parts. A section of red is along one side, next to which is a patch of brown. On the lower half, there are green, yellow, blue, and brown areas with multi-colored drips.
Subject:
Abstract
Object Type:
Sculpture
Owner:
Dia Art Foundation, New York, New York
Provenance:
Acquired from Lone Star Foundation, New York, New York 1978-1980.
Formerly in the collection of Heiner Friedrich, Inc., New York, New York
References:
Sylvester, Julie, "John Chamberlain: A Catalogue Raisonne of the Sculpture, 1954-1985," NY: Hudson Hills Press, 1986, no. 566.
Illustration:
Sylvester, Julie, "John Chamberlain: A Catalogue Raisonne of the Sculpture, 1954-1985," New York: Hudson Hills Press, 1986, pg. 154.
